Output 68a23137c36ddef1e5ce8f68d4aa903b075a30057db5a5ac0fb18ff404d6ce52:0

value
4379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efc57e3fb9a0ca14bed116606364359b40900fd6 OP_EQUAL
address
3PYp1TS3FUHCD7wUL1PrZNjMXokHuVxPnN
transaction
68a23137c36ddef1e5ce8f68d4aa903b075a30057db5a5ac0fb18ff404d6ce52